Bitcoin's Four-Year Cycle May Give Way to Six-to-Eight-Year Debt Rhythm, Analysts Say

The long-standing assumption that bitcoin moves in predictable four-year cycles driven by halving events is facing renewed scrutiny as institutional capital reshapes the market's underlying structure.

On-chain analyst Willy Woo has put forward a view that the cryptocurrency may be transitioning toward a six-to-eight-year cycle, one increasingly tethered to the debt and liquidity conditions that govern traditional financial markets rather than the supply shocks created by mining reward reductions.

His argument rests on a simple but consequential shift: each halving now removes a much smaller slice of new supply from the equation. After the April 2024 halving, annual new bitcoin issuance fell to roughly 0.8% of the existing supply. The next event, expected in early 2028, will cut that figure to about 0.4%.

As freshly mined coins become a negligible fraction of what is already in circulation, the halving's power to dictate broader price cycles naturally diminishes, Woo contends. What may replace it, he suggests, is the rhythm of the traditional financial system's short-term debt cycle, which typically spans six to eight years and is driven by credit expansion, interest rates, and global liquidity conditions.
